What Problems Does the 2016 Freightliner B2 Bus Have?

The 2016 Freightliner B2 Bus, like many commercial vehicles, is built for longevity and extensive use, which means its issues tend to revolve around wear and tear rather than inherent design flaws. However, some common areas that owners and operators have reported over time include:

Powertrain Components: While Cummins and Detroit Diesel engines are generally very reliable, high mileage and demanding usage can lead to issues with fuel injectors, turbochargers, and the exhaust gas recirculation (EGR) system. Regular maintenance is critical. Transmission issues, particularly with automatic transmissions like Allison models often paired with these engines, can arise from heavy loads and frequent shifting. Clutch wear (if manual transmission) or torque converter problems are also possible.

Brake System: Given the vehicle's weight and purpose, brake wear is a constant concern. Issues can include premature pad and rotor wear, caliper problems, or hydraulic leaks. Air brake systems, common on these vehicles, require diligent maintenance to prevent leaks or component failures.

Suspension and Steering: Heavy-duty suspensions and steering components are designed to be robust, but they are subject to significant stress. Leaf spring issues, worn bushings, ball joint wear, and steering linkage problems can occur, especially on vehicles operating on rougher roads or carrying consistently heavy loads.

Electrical System: While less common than mechanical wear, electrical gremlins can manifest. Issues with alternators, starter motors, battery drains, and wiring harness faults can occur, particularly in older units or those exposed to harsh environments. Diagnostic trouble codes (DTCs) are common indicators.

HVAC System: The heating, ventilation, and air conditioning (HVAC) systems on buses are critical for passenger comfort and can be complex. Compressor failures, refrigerant leaks, fan motor issues, or control module malfunctions are not uncommon, especially with continuous operation.

Recalls: Specific recalls for the 2016 Freightliner B2 Bus would need to be checked against the National Highway Traffic Safety Administration (NHTSA) database using the VIN. However, common recall areas for heavy-duty vehicles of this era might include issues with braking systems, seatbelt assemblies, fuel system components, or specific engine or transmission control modules. It's crucial for any prospective buyer to verify the recall status of a specific vehicle.

Long-Term Reliability Concerns: The long-term reliability is highly dependent on the maintenance schedule followed. A well-maintained B2 Bus can last for hundreds of thousands of miles. Conversely, neglected maintenance will accelerate wear and lead to more frequent and costly repairs. The chassis itself is generally sound, but the ancillary systems and components are where issues are most likely to arise over extended service life. Model year specific issues are less common for a chassis like this compared to a mass-produced passenger car, as variations are more about specification and body builder integration than a single evolving model. However, changes in engine emissions standards or braking system technologies could lead to year-over-year variations in complexity.

How long will the 2016 Freightliner B2 Bus last?

The 2016 Freightliner B2 Bus is engineered for extensive service life. With consistent, professional maintenance, it's not uncommon for these buses to accumulate between 300,000 to 500,000 miles, and even more in some applications. Many operate for 15-20 years or longer. The core chassis and powertrain are incredibly durable. However, longevity is directly tied to maintenance. Weaknesses over time typically appear in wearable components like brakes, suspension parts, and exhaust systems due to constant heavy use. Electrical components and HVAC systems can also require attention as the vehicle ages. Proper lubrication, fluid changes, and timely replacement of worn parts are paramount to achieving maximum service life. Neglect is the primary determinant of premature failure.

Crash-Test Ratings:
Commercial bus chassis like the Freightliner B2 are not subjected to consumer-style crash testing (e.g., by IIHS or NHTSA for passenger cars). Instead, their safety is evaluated based on rigorous commercial vehicle standards, focusing on structural integrity, braking performance, and the safe integration of passenger bodies. Specific crash-test ratings are not publicly available in the same format as passenger vehicles.

2016 Freightliner B2 Bus Prices and Market Value

When new, the 2016 Freightliner B2 Bus chassis could range widely from approximately $60,000 to over $100,000, depending heavily on engine choice, transmission, and specific chassis configurations. Once a body was added and upfitted, the final price for a complete bus could easily reach $150,000 to $300,000 or more.

On the used market today, prices for a 2016 Freightliner B2 Bus chassis, or a complete bus with a body, can vary significantly. A well-maintained unit with lower mileage might fetch anywhere from $20,000 to $60,000 or more. Higher mileage or units requiring significant refurbishment will be at the lower end.

Depreciation is substantial in the first few years, but after the initial drop, the Freightliner B2 Bus holds its value relatively well due to its inherent durability and demand in commercial sectors. Key factors affecting resale value include mileage, overall condition, maintenance history, the quality and condition of the added body, and the presence of any desirable features like wheelchair lifts. Buses that have been used for demanding routes or poorly maintained will depreciate much faster.
